The Opportunity
Uralla Shire Council is seeking two enthusiastic and customer-focused Library Assistants to join our Community Services team.
Working as part of a small and supportive team, you will help deliver high-quality library and information services to our community. This varied role combines customer service, technology support, collection management, administration, and assistance with library programs and activities.
